DFR: How Public Safety Can Leverage Drones for Any Type of Incident



In public safety, every second counts. Not just a paramedic unit arriving on the scene for a heart attack or for COVID. How about law enforcement showing up on scene to a fight to find 20 people in a clash? Would it be beneficial for the fire department, to respond to an alarm for a big box store, to have size up before arriving, so additional alarms could be called before arriving on the scene?


The Drone as a First Responder program also known as DFR is starting to make its way across the United States. Chula Vista Police Department in Southern California was the first to start their program in 2018 to take advantage of having an eye in the sky, so emergency responders can have situation awareness before arriving on scene.
